The following instructions are intended to assist the
user in starting the GA-6HA AC Generator. Please read
the entire instructions before starting.

GA-6HA AC Generator

Starting Instructions

Engine Oil Check

1. To check the engine oil level, place the generator on

secure level ground with the engine stopped.

2. Remove the filler cap/dipstick from the engine oil filler

hole and wipe it clean.

3. Insert and remove the dipstick without screwing it into

the filler neck. Check the oil level shown on the
dipstick.

4. If the oil level is low (Figure 1), fill to the edge of the

oil filler hole with the recommended oil type (Table 1).
Maximum oil capacity is 1.16 quarts (1.1 liters).

Gasoline

is extremely flammable, and its

vapors can cause an explosion if ignited.

DO

NOT

start the engine near spilled fuel

or combustible fluids.

DO NOT

fill the fuel tank while the engine is running or

hot.

DO NOT

overfill tank, since spilled fuel could ignite if

it comes into contact with hot engine parts or sparks from
the ignition system. Store fuel in approved containers, in
well-ventilated areas and away from sparks and flames.

Fuel Check

1. Close the fuel cock before filling the fuel tank.

2. Remove the fuel cap located on top of fuel tank.

3. Read the fuel gauge located on top of the fuel tank (Figure

2) to determine if the fuel level is low. If fuel is low,
replenish with

clean unleaded fuel

.

4. When refueling, be sure to use a strainer for filtration.

DO

NOT

top-off fuel.

DO NOT

fill the tank beyond

capacity. Wipe up any spilled fuel

immediately!

Figure 2. Fuel Gauge

Before Starting the Engine

1. Be sure to

disconnect all electrical loads

from the

generator prior to starting the engine.

2.

NEVER

start the engine with the main

circuit breaker

in the

ON

position. Always place the main circuit

breaker (Figure 3) in the

OFF

position before starting.
